Why Strong Tech Doesn't Win Overseas Orders
85% of B2B purchasing decisions are influenced by digital content (Demand Gen Report 2024), yet only 12% of Chinese manufacturers consistently produce professional-grade technical documentation—meaning that no matter how strong your tech is, lacking compelling content is like giving up your ticket to trust.
A certain industrial robot manufacturer missed out on a German order worth over €2 million because it lacked a German-language compliance white paper: the customer wasn’t questioning the product itself, but couldn’t complete internal approval. This shows that missing content equals lost trust and stalled business opportunities. Even deeper, vast amounts of technical data remain locked in engineers’ hard drives, never transformed into searchable, traceable multilingual content assets.

How to Build a Dynamic Content Factory with an AI Toolchain
When a five-axis machine tool achieves micron-level precision, yet customers only see static parameter tables—that’s the disconnect between “high value, low conversion.” The solution lies in building an AI-driven dynamic content factory: extracting technical highlights from CAD/BOM data (such as ±0.002mm precision), matching them with application scenarios (like battery casing machining), and automatically generating structured content modules like “Five Advantages of Five-Axis Machine Tools in New Energy Scenarios.”
This automation means content update efficiency increases by 20 times, since you don’t need to manually plan each blog post or landing page; combined with Google SEO optimization, one company’s organic traffic surged into the industry’s top 3 within three months, reducing customer acquisition costs by 41% (Cross-Border Industrial Goods Digital Marketing Benchmark Report, 2024).
The real competitive edge is closed-loop optimization: behavioral data such as user dwell time and PDF download rates are fed back to the AI engine in real time, triggering content iterations. For example, if “energy-saving features” convert well, the system automatically boosts their weight—meaning your technical messaging always aligns with buyer decision logic, continuously improving conversion efficiency.
